Shilpa Shinde-Indian Television Actress

Early Life: Shilpa Shinde

Shilpa Shinde was born on August 28, 1977, in Mumbai, Maharashtra, into a middle-class family. She hails from a Marathi-speaking background, and her father, a businessman, had a significant influence on her upbringing. Shilpa’s early life was filled with aspirations to pursue a career in acting. She completed her schooling in Mumbai and later pursued her college education in the city. Despite her family’s initial disapproval of her career choice, Shilpa remained determined to follow her passion for acting.

Before entering the world of television, Shilpa had always shown interest in acting, theater, and dramatics. She made her acting debut at a young age, initially appearing in a few Marathi television shows. However, it wasn’t until she ventured into Hindi television that she gained widespread recognition and fame.

Career Beginnings (2001–2013)

Shilpa Shinde’s career in the entertainment industry began with her entry into the world of television. She made her debut in the early 2000s with roles in several TV serials, though she initially faced difficulty in finding substantial roles. Her breakthrough came when she was cast as a lead in the TV serial Bhabhi (2002-2008), which aired on STAR Plus. The show was a success and marked a turning point in Shilpa’s career, giving her recognition and a steady fanbase.

However, it was her portrayal of the character Angoori Bhabhi in the popular sitcom Bhabiji Ghar Par Hain! (2015-2017) that truly cemented her place in Indian television history. Shilpa became a household name thanks to her portrayal of the sweet and naïve Angoori Bhabhi, a role that won her millions of fans and the love of audiences across India. The show was a major success, and Shilpa’s comic timing and portrayal of the character made her one of the most beloved actresses on television.

Before her role in Bhabiji Ghar Par Hain!, Shilpa appeared in a variety of shows, including Meera (2009) and Chidiya Ghar (2011), where she played significant roles that helped her gain more experience in the industry.

Rise to Fame (2015–2017)

Shilpa Shinde’s career saw its peak with her portrayal of Angoori Bhabhi in Bhabiji Ghar Par Hain!. The show, which premiered in 2015, became immensely popular due to its light-hearted comedy and Shilpa’s impeccable comic timing. As Angoori Bhabhi, she delivered a memorable performance that earned her widespread praise from both critics and the audience. Her role was a refreshing take on the traditional bhabhi character, and her hilarious dialogues and innocent portrayal became a major highlight of the show.

Her performance won her several awards, including the prestigious Indian Television Academy Award for Best Actress in a Comic Role. Shilpa’s portrayal of Angoori Bhabhi became iconic, and she became one of the most recognized faces on Indian television.

However, in 2017, Shilpa Shinde was unexpectedly involved in a controversy when she had a fallout with the production team of Bhabiji Ghar Par Hain! and was reportedly fired from the show. The situation created a lot of media buzz, and Shilpa later accused the makers of the show of mistreatment. The fallout was a major setback in her career, but it also led to new opportunities for Shilpa in the entertainment industry.

Reality Television (2017–2018)

After her departure from Bhabiji Ghar Par Hain!, Shilpa Shinde decided to explore new avenues in her career, leading her to appear as a contestant on the popular reality television show Bigg Boss 11 (2017). Her entry into the show was a major turning point for her career, as she gained immense popularity and support from the audience. Shilpa’s candid and unapologetic personality made her stand out on the show, and she quickly became a fan favorite.

Throughout her time on Bigg Boss 11, Shilpa engaged in several arguments and conflicts with fellow contestants, which added drama and excitement to the show. Her witty remarks, emotional moments, and resilience made her one of the most talked-about contestants of that season. Shilpa’s journey on Bigg Boss culminated with her winning the season, marking a significant achievement in her career. Her victory on the show earned her a massive fanbase and a resurgence in her career, making her one of the most celebrated television personalities in India.

Personal Life: Shilpa Shinde

Shilpa Shinde’s personal life has often been the subject of media attention. She was in a long-term relationship with actor Romit Raj, though the relationship ended in 2009. Shilpa has remained private about her relationships post that, and she keeps her personal life away from the media spotlight.

She is known for her love of animals and her commitment to animal welfare. Shilpa is also active on social media, where she frequently shares her thoughts, opinions, and glimpses of her daily life with her fans.

Controversies: Shilpa Shinde

Shilpa Shinde’s career has been marked by a few controversies, the most significant being her fallout with the makers of Bhabiji Ghar Par Hain! in 2017. Shilpa accused the production team of mistreating her, which led to her exit from the show. This controversy sparked a lot of discussions in the media, with some supporting Shilpa’s claims and others defending the producers. The incident was one of the key moments in her career, and it led to a dramatic turn when Shilpa joined Bigg Boss 11, eventually winning the show.

Shilpa also faced criticism at times for her outspoken nature, which occasionally led to conflicts with co-stars and other personalities in the industry. Despite the controversies, Shilpa’s loyal fan following has always stood by her.

Controversies

  • Legal Battle with TV Serial Makers: Left Bhabhi Ji Ghar Par Hai in 2016 due to issues with the production house and filed an FIR for sexual harassment against Sanjay Kohli.
  • Tiff with Vikas Gupta: Accused him of taking acting projects from her during Bigg Boss.
  • Twitter Fight with Gauahar Khan: Engaged in a Twitter war over comments made about Bigg Boss.
  • Leaked MMS Incident: Cleared allegations of being involved in an adult video that went viral.
  • Feud with TV Producers: Accused of quitting a show without informing producers, resulting in a public dispute.

Lesser-Known Facts

  • Her father initially wanted her to become a lawyer, and her parents were not supportive of her acting career at first.
  • In 2001, she acted in the Telugu film Shivani.
  • She gained recognition for her role in Chidiya Ghar (2011) and has appeared in various TV serials, including Devon Ke Dev…Mahadev (2013) and Maddam Sir (2023).
  • After her father’s death in 2013, she faced depression.
  • She participated in Bigg Boss 11 in 2017, where she revealed her tumultuous relationship with actor Sidharth Shukla.
  • Shilpa won Bigg Boss 11 on January 14, 2018, and is known for her strong personality and outspoken nature.
